NHTSARecalled Nov 29, 2023 · #23V804000
Incorrect Propane Line Fittings May Cause Fire

Tiffin Motorhomes, Inc. (Tiffin) is recalling certain 2024 Allegro Open Road and Allegro Bay motorhomes. The 32-inch hard line LPG hose fitting may not fit correctly, which can cause a fuel leak. A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source increases the risk of a fire.

What you should do
Dealers will replace the 32-inch hose with a 40-inch hose,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ed January 28, 2024. Owners may contact Tiffin customer service at 1-256-356-8661. Tiffin's number for this recall is TIF-134.
